What is Bilingual Website Development?
Bilingual website development refers to the process of creating websites that can communicate in two languages, catering to a broader audience. This approach not only enhances user experience but also opens up new market opportunities. Steps to Implement Bilingual Website Development
- Define Your Target Audience: Identify the languages spoken by your potential customers.
- Select the Right Platform: Choose a website platform that supports multilingual content.
- Content Creation: Develop high-quality content for both languages, ensuring cultural relevancy.
- SEO Strategy: Optimize each language version for search engines.
- Testing: Ensure all functions work correctly in both languages before going live.
- Regular Updates: Keep content updated in both languages for consistency.
Best Practices for Bilingual Websites
- Use Language Switchers: Implement easy-to-find language selection options on your site.
- Separate URLs for Languages: Use different URLs for different language versions (e.g., domain.com/en and domain.com/fr).
- Consistent Layout: Keep the layout and design consistent across all language versions.
- Test for Usability: Regularly test the site for usability in both languages.
